Michael Glatze

Michael Glatze (born c. 1975) is the co-founder of Young Gay America and a former advocate for gay rights. He received media coverage for publicly announcing that he no longer identified as a homosexual and now denounced homosexuality.
==Biography==
Glatze was born in Olympia, Washington. His mother was a non-denominational Christian and his father was agnostic.〔Nicolos, Joseph. 〕 His father died of a heart condition when Glatze was 13, and his mother died when he was 19. Glatze earned a bachelor's degree from Dartmouth College where he majored in English literature and creative writing, with a minor in music.
While working at ''XY Magazine'' in San Francisco, Glatze met Benjie Nycum. The two would end up being boyfriends for 10 years. They later co-founded their own publication, ''Young Gay America'' magazine (YGA Mag).〔 Glatze and Nycum coauthored the book ''XY Survival Guide'' (2000).
In 2005, Glatze was quoted by ''Time'' magazine saying "I don't think the gay movement understands the extent to which the next generation just wants to be normal kids. The people who are getting that are the Christian right."
Glatze turned toward Christianity after a health scare due to heart palpitations.〔 Worried that he was affected by the same heart condition which claimed his father's life, he sought medical help. The palpitations turned out to be due to anemia, caused by celiac disease. He joined The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in the first half of 2007 but left shortly thereafter.〔
Glatze has written two pieces about his change which appeared in online media outlet ''WorldNetDaily''. He has also received media coverage in other publications and in the book ''16 Amazing Stories of Divine Intervention'' as well as several blogs.〔 Glatze currently lives in La Grange, Wyoming.〔
A movie titled ''I Am Michael'' based on his life starring James Franco is set to premiere at the 2015 Sundance Film Festival.
